Abstract:

A high stability and output energy of wide band tunable intelligence optical parametric oscillator is developed by which square pulse YAG laser in temporal domain pumped. By means of the smooth cavity dumping, the reduction of output loss compensates the photon decrease in cavity. In experiment, we have investigated energy conversion efficiency to compare the Gaussian pulse with square pulse and obtained the 16.5% to 34.5% energy conversion efficiency of the optical parametric oscillator by the square pulse pumped. © 2000 SPIE.
